An independent accuracy certification, most commonly from COSC, awarded to individual movements that pass a multi-position, multi-temperature timing test.
Chronometer certification applies to the movement, not the finished watch, and is usually marked on the movement or dial, for example as "Chronometer" or "Officially Certified." A watch claiming chronometer status without the corresponding marking, or with timing performance far outside chronometer tolerance, is inconsistent with a genuine certified example.
